3. Content Guidelines

  • Write original and engaging content.

  • Maintain a consistent tone: casual, informative, and friendly.

  • Include images, infographics, or media when relevant.

  • Use SEO-friendly titles, meta descriptions, and keywords.

  • Post regularly (e.g., 2–3 times a week).

6. Maintenance & Updates

  • Regularly update plugins/widgets and templates.

  • Backup content monthly.

  • Monitor website performance and fix broken links.

  • Respond to comments and emails promptly.
